While most TCUs are … Web3 mrt. 2024 · Montana is home to seven Tribal Colleges and Universities, the most of any state. These institutions serve thousands of Native and hundreds of non-Native students every year. Across the country, there are 37 Tribal Colleges and Universities operating 75 campuses in 16 states.

Web15 mrt. 2024 · Diné College. Diné College, founded as Navajo Community College in 1968, was the United States’ first tribally chartered college. It serves a predominantly Navajo population, spanning across Arizona, New Mexico, and Utah, and is ranked in the top 5% nationally for the most-focused health professions programs.
